Our Technology

AQUA® technology brings standardization and reproducibility to IHC analysis. Automated fluorescent image acquisition and data analysis use our proprietary software to provide precise quantification of biomarkers of interest, based on the computation of AQUA scores. This can then be correlated with other parameters such as disease progression, clinical outcome, and response to therapy or expression of proteins in alternate pathways.

Quantitative, standardized and reproducible analysis of protein biomarkers in tissue

Imagine combining the best of ELISA and immunohistochemistry (IHC) into one powerful platform. That’s what you get with AQUA technology (Automated Quantitative Analysis).

AQUA is an automated image analysis platform that brings objective results to the multiparametric analysis of protein in tissues, providing results that are:

  • Quantitative—AQUA technology quantitates protein expression within subcellular compartments in tissue automatically and with a high degree of precision similar to ELISA.
  • Standardized and reproducible—imaging and scoring occurs through proprietary software-enabled analysis
  • Discretely localized—maintains tissue morphology similar to IHC, but without its inherent subjectivity.
  • Ease of use—through automation and simple operation
  • High resolution—superior to traditional chromagen-based immunohistochemical analysis.
  • Multiplex-capable—for complex analyses.

AQUA technology utilizes fluorescence-labeled antibodies and molecular markers to maximize dynamic range and sensitivity, the foundation for computing an AQUA score. AQUA scores enable truly quantitative assessment of protein biomarkers in fixed tissue, which can then be correlated with other parameters such as disease progression, clinical outcome, response to therapy or expression of proteins in alternate pathways.
